Vernon grad wins National Cheer Title at Angelo State

SAN ANGELO — For the fifth straight year, the Angelo State University Cheer Team has won a national title at the United Spirit Association USA Collegiate Championships in Anaheim, Calif. Vernon High School graduate Jaila McBride is a member of the team.
ASU’s 32-member co-ed Cheer Team, including Jaila McBride of Vernon, won one national championship and also recorded one runner-up performance, two national third-place finishes and a fifth-place finish in the College Game Day division, including:
— First Place – College Situational Sideline Contest
— Second Place – Mascot Contest
— Third Place – College Fight Song Contest
— Third Place – College Band Chant Contest
— Fifth Place – Co-Ed Show Cheer Performance Routine
The ASU Cheer Team previously won 2018 and 2019 national championships in the Show Cheer division, as well as 2020 and 2021 national championships in the College Game Day division.
